Wood

Ross Potter

Ross Potter invites audiences to contemplate their perception of the natural world through his new project WOOD. The under-appreciation or destruction of the natural world is reflected thematically in this new exhibition. Captured in thought provoking detail, Potter’s latest works will draw you closer to these very simple and often overlooked subjects, creating a sense of wonder and a new appreciation for all things that grow.

Originally from Brisbane, Potter made his move to the West Coast in 2007, working in the steel industry and creating art in his spare time. In 2011 he decided to take his art more seriously with the creation of his first solo exhibition. Potter’s passion for the arts continued to grow as his practice developed, leading him to pursue his artistic career full time in 2013. Using Graphite on Paper, Potter dedicates his time to capturing the details in our everyday lives and finds escapism can exist in the simplicity of our very own reality. Altering perspectives and challenging our sense of place, Potter’s work captures the slow evolution of the urban landscape and how we as a community interact with our surroundings.
